Output a775528af0ecd1d110829953166c4491d58d2614dc23671ea0b5ecffaed94e2d:50

value
137016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c4be375f9bf460da0813195c52302614b676c02 OP_EQUAL
address
38eSBx2hmQNwoZX7avxTJvTttsZTWxxqvp
transaction
a775528af0ecd1d110829953166c4491d58d2614dc23671ea0b5ecffaed94e2d
confirmations
3651
spent
true